I'll contribute something, though it's a small tale of woe.
Previously, I posted having gone to Auto Details (155 Street and 105 Ave) for some small damage repair. I was please with the work (May, 2014), though a bit disappointed when I noticed what appeared to be a couple of door dings on the repaired side on 6 months later. I put off doing anything about the dings, as it didn't look like it was through the paint.
Last Friday night, I went through a wash (touchless), and the following morning, noticed that a patch of clearcoat had flaked away from the bottom of the rear driver side door. My initial reaction was to be pissed with the wash, but it didn't take long to realize that this was not usual, and then I realized it was on the spot that had been previously repaired.
I'll see about posting some pics by the weekend.
I took it to Topline, and they agreed it wasn't the fault of the wash. Said it was unusual, but they've seen that happen on rare occasion, and that it should certainly be warrantied.
So I went back to Auto Details and showed them. They seemed surprised as well, but then suggested that it could happen if rocks hit the side of my car, and water got into the chips. That's not the case here, and it was pretty obvious; the rest of the car is pristine (at least as pristine as one can expect for a 2009), whereas the door in question has several small "bubble" spots, some flaking that's ready to go around the handle, and the big flaked portion already discussed. But no rock chips or pits. Their offer: they can fix it for $599, but I'd only be on the hook for half ($299) plus shop supplies (another $45) and GST.
Topline has offered to work on their price for me, and even give me some sort of credit for a gift certificate I have at Auto Details. It would still be more at Topline, but I'm tempted to go that route, if only because I know it will be done right.

@sockpuppet - Yikes, that sounds brutal. Once clear coat failure hits, there is no fix to it besides a repaint. From what you described, I definitely wouldn't go back to the first company considering they did such a poor job the first go around. For the clear to fail in such a short amount of time, it makes me wonder how experienced their painter is. The process to a respray can be finicky and if they were impatient or didn't do it right, it leads to premature failure. It's disappointing to hear they aren't willing to own up and fix the door at their own cost. I don't see how it's the users fault unless you went and polished the paint like a mad man or wet sanded it down (which I highly doubt you did).

yea I'll let you know. There is a write up on this site too, take a look and read it a few times over. You will realize that if you can take a wheel off and undo 4 bolts per side up front and 4-5 bolts per side in the back, you can do this job. back is harder because you have to take out the back seat, but that's like 2-3 screws I think, again, there is a detailed write up on it as well.
